There are handbags, and then there are cultural symbols — pieces that shape style, define eras, and whisper identity before you ever say a word. The Fendi Baguette has always belonged to the latter.
Immortalized by Carrie Bradshaw in Sex and the City, the Baguette became the original "It Bag" of the 90s and early 2000s — the era where fashion was personal, expressive, and joyfully indulgent. Carrie didn’t just wear the Baguette; she carried a story. A personality. A declaration.

Designed in 1997 by Silvia Venturini Fendi, the Baguette was intentionally small, meant to be tucked under the arm like a French loaf. It was clever. It was feminine. And it arrived at exactly the moment fashion needed something playful.
Decades later, the Baguette remains:
Highly recognizable yet deeply customizable
Investment-worthy due to limited collabs & capsule releases
A personal signature piece for women who curate, not shop
